How much protein is in rice noodles?

A typical 1 cup cooked serving of rice noodles contains 3.2 grams of protein (1.79 g per 100 g), which makes it a moderate source of protein. That covers roughly 6% of the 50 g reference Daily Value, so it adds toward your protein total for the day.

Only about 7% of the calories in rice noodles come from protein, so it is more of an energy food than a protein food. It is worth eating for other reasons; the protein it adds to a day is incidental.

Among the 111 grains in the database, rice noodles ranks 77th by protein per serving, and 585th out of all 796 foods on the site. Set against dinner roll, another grain entry in the database, a serving carries about 0.5 g more protein (dinner roll has 2.7 g per 1 roll).

It is an incomplete protein on its own; pairing it with other plant foods across the day covers the full range of essential amino acids. The serving above is measured by volume at 176 g. The per-100 g figure lets you compare it directly against any other food here, whatever its serving.

Made from rice flour only, so noticeably lower in protein than wheat pasta.

Source: USDA FoodData Central #168914 - "Rice noodles, cooked" (SR Legacy, published 4/1/2019). Values are the published reference figures for that record, not lab measurements for a specific brand or batch.
